From: Jim Blandy Date: Mon, 8 Feb 2010 19:27:34 +0000 (+0000) Subject: * dwarf.c (display_debug_frames): Skip the 'S' character in CFI X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=d80e8de27fad4f09083d6b61332d2c9ab87c2079;p=binutils-gdb.git * dwarf.c (display_debug_frames): Skip the 'S' character in CFI 'z' augmentation strings. --- diff --git a/binutils/ChangeLog b/binutils/ChangeLog index 33bfd3ec26c..8987c417537 100644 --- a/binutils/ChangeLog +++ b/binutils/ChangeLog @@ -1,3 +1,8 @@ +2010-02-08 Jim Blandy + + * dwarf.c (display_debug_frames): Skip the 'S' character in CFI + 'z' augmentation strings. + 2010-02-08 Christophe Lyon * objdump.c (disassemble_bytes): Clear aux->reloc before printing diff --git a/binutils/dwarf.c b/binutils/dwarf.c index 93eb15a79bc..0e143322712 100644 --- a/binutils/dwarf.c +++ b/binutils/dwarf.c @@ -4114,6 +4114,8 @@ display_debug_frames (struct dwarf_section *section, q += 1 + size_of_encoded_value (*q); else if (*p == 'R') fc->fde_encoding = *q++; + else if (*p == 'S') + ; else break; p++;